Former Twitter CEO Parag Agrawal’s AI Search Startup Parallel Raises $100 Million in Series A Funding
Parag Agrawal, the ex-CEO of Twitter, has successfully raised $100 million in Series A funding for his new AI search startup, Parallel Web Systems, at a valuation of approximately $740 million. This significant investment underscores growing confidence in Parallel’s vision to revolutionize how artificial intelligence interacts with and utilizes the internet for search and data retrieval.
Background and Funding Details
Parag Agrawal, who led Twitter before stepping down, founded Parallel Web Systems with the goal of building innovative AI tools that enhance search capabilities beyond traditional methods. Unlike conventional search engines, Parallel focuses on developing APIs and infrastructure tailored for AI applications, allowing them to access and interpret web data with greater efficiency and accuracy.
The recent $100 million Series A funding round was led by prominent venture capital firms, signaling strong market belief in Parallel’s approach and potential impact on AI-driven search technologies. This round brings the company’s valuation close to three-quarters of a billion dollars, marking a remarkable milestone for a startup that is still in its early stages.
What Is Parallel Web Systems Building?
Parallel Web Systems aims to redefine internet search by creating AI-ready search infrastructure. Traditional search engines primarily focus on keyword matching and page ranking algorithms, but Parallel is developing tools that allow AI systems to:
- Access clean, structured data from across the internet
- Query and retrieve information in a way that supports natural language understanding and reasoning
- Provide APIs that enable companies and developers to build more intelligent, context-aware AI applications
This approach is designed to address current challenges in AI search, such as data noise, misinformation, and inefficient access to relevant knowledge. Parallel’s technology could enable more precise and reliable AI-powered assistants, chatbots, and other applications that depend on rapid, nuanced access to web data.
Industry Context and Implications
The AI search market is rapidly evolving, with major players like Google, Microsoft, and newer AI startups competing to leverage large language models and machine learning for enhanced search experiences. Parallel's focus on building foundational infrastructure that supports AI-specific search needs positions it uniquely in the ecosystem.
Agrawal’s leadership and Twitter background bring significant credibility and industry insight, attracting top-tier investors. The $100 million funding round not only fuels product development but also supports scaling efforts to capture a share of the growing AI infrastructure market.
This funding round reflects a broader trend of investors pouring capital into AI startups that innovate on data accessibility and AI integration, which are critical for the next wave of technology advancement.
